Synology HA Cluster Ausfallszenarien

Aus Thomas-Krenn-Wiki
Zur Navigation springen Zur Suche springen
Hinweis: Bitte beachten Sie, dass dieser Artikel / diese Kategorie sich entweder auf ältere Software/Hardware Komponenten bezieht oder aus sonstigen Gründen nicht mehr gewartet wird.
Diese Seite wird nicht mehr aktualisiert und ist rein zu Referenzzwecken noch hier im Archiv abrufbar.

Dieser Artikel beschreibt Ausfallszenarien eines Hochverfügbarkeit-Clusters (High Availability - HA) anhand zweier Synology Netzwerkspeicher-Geräte (NAS) unter DiskStation Manager (DSM) 5.0. Der Artikel Synology HA Cluster Konfiguration erläutert die Konfiguration eines Synology HA Clusters.

Ausfallszenarien

Nachfolgend werden praxistypische Probleme und deren Lösung aufgelistet.

Festplatte am passiven NAS entfernt

Festplatte am aktiven NAS entfernt

Alle Festplatten am aktiven NAS entfernt

Es ist ein Rebuild des Volumes wie beim Entfernen einer einzelnen Festplatte erforderlich.

Versehentliches Ausschalten

Bei einem Versehentlichen Ausschalten des aktiven Servers übernimmt der passive Server die Dienste.
Die Weboberfläche ist kurz (im Test ca. 2 Minuten) nicht erreichbar.
Gestartete Services (z.B. Mediawiki) sind ebenso nicht erreichbar.

Heartbeat-Verbindung unterbrochen

LAN-Verbindung des aktiven Servers getrennt

Nach dem Entfernen der LAN-Verbindung des aktiven Servers sind die aktiven Services nicht mehr erreichbar.
Die Weboberfläche ist ebenso nicht mehr erreichbar.
Nach etwa 2 Minuten erfolgt ein Wechsel auf den passiven Server und die Oberfläche sowie Services sind wieder funktional.

LAN-Verbindung des passiven Servers getrennt

Netzstecker am passiven NAS abgezogen

Zuerst wird gemeldet dass die Heartbeat-Connection down ist, anschließend Failed to detect passive server..

Netzstecker am aktiven NAS abgezogen

Nach dem Entfernen des Netzsteckers sind die aktiven Services nicht mehr erreichbar.
Die Weboberfläche ist ebenso nicht mehr erreichbar.
Nach etwa 2 Minuten erfolgt ein Wechsel auf den passiven Server und die Oberfläche sowie Services sind wieder funktional.

Ausgaben von: cat /proc/drbd

Netzstecker abgesteckt

version: 8.4.1 (api:1/proto:86-100)
GIT-hash: b8c4884c526fb7ede9074bf560471f1f25ce58f4 build by root@build5, 2014-01-20 02:40:30
 0: cs:WFConnection ro:Primary/Unknown ds:UpToDate/DUnknown C r--u-- vg1-volume_1
    ns:0 nr:6144 dw:9076 dr:60545 al:16 bm:2 lo:0 pe:0 ua:0 ap:0 ep:1 wo:b oos:9728

Netzstecker wieder angesteckt und NAS bootet

version: 8.4.1 (api:1/proto:86-100)
GIT-hash: b8c4884c526fb7ede9074bf560471f1f25ce58f4 build by root@build5, 2014-01-20 02:40:30
 0: cs:PausedSyncS ro:Primary/Secondary ds:UpToDate/Inconsistent C r-p--- vg1-volume_1
    ns:0 nr:6144 dw:9864 dr:60585 al:18 bm:2 lo:0 pe:0 ua:0 ap:0 ep:1 wo:b oos:245760

Synchronisationsprozess

version: 8.4.1 (api:1/proto:86-100)
GIT-hash: b8c4884c526fb7ede9074bf560471f1f25ce58f4 build by root@build5, 2014-01-20 02:40:30
 0: cs:SyncSource ro:Primary/Secondary ds:UpToDate/Inconsistent C r----- vg1-volume_1
    ns:70328 nr:6144 dw:9864 dr:193969 al:18 bm:2 lo:10 pe:61 ua:256 ap:0 ep:1 wo:b oos:190976
	[===================>] sync'ed:100.0% (0/472064)M
	finish: 0:00:57 speed: 2,304 (54,784) K/sec

HA wieder funktional

version: 8.4.1 (api:1/proto:86-100)
GIT-hash: b8c4884c526fb7ede9074bf560471f1f25ce58f4 build by root@build5, 2014-01-20 02:40:30
 0: cs:Connected ro:Primary/Secondary ds:UpToDate/UpToDate C r----- vg1-volume_1
    ns:245760 nr:6144 dw:9864 dr:306465 al:18 bm:4 lo:0 pe:0 ua:0 ap:0 ep:1 wo:b oos:0


Foto Thomas Niedermeier.jpg

Autor: Thomas Niedermeier

Thomas Niedermeier arbeitet im Product Management Team von Thomas-Krenn. Er absolvierte an der Hochschule Deggendorf sein Studium zum Bachelor Wirtschaftsinformatik. Seit 2013 ist Thomas bei Thomas-Krenn beschäftigt und kümmert sich unter anderem um OPNsense Firewalls, das Thomas-Krenn-Wiki und Firmware Sicherheitsupdates.

Icon-Twitter.png 

Das könnte Sie auch interessieren

Synology DiskStation Manager (DSM) 5.0
Synology NAS Monitoring Plugin
TKmon Servicechecks für Synology NAS